The “mommy wars”– the so-called conflict between moms (or parenting philosophies) over topics related to motherhood – are a constant cultural undercurrent. But occasionally some development blasts them into the public domain, such as the recent Time Magazine cover story on attachment parenting or Democratic strategist Hilary Rosen’s comment about Ann Romney never working a day in her life.

When this happens, media outlets declare that the “mommy wars” are sowing dissent among women across America. American moms then make the requisite call for a ceasefire. The common refrain on Facebook and Twitter feeds goes something like this: Motherhood is hard enough, so why can’t we just stop the hostility and agree to get along?

But a ceasefire is not the answer. The “mommy wars” are good for America. They are actually a social, political, and cultural dialogue, rooted in the open exchange of ideas, a principle enshrined in the freedom of speech.
